can i use a usb cable to set up my new hp officejet pro 9015e? the port is covered by a sticker.

— asked by Dave

Yeah, this one's a common point of confusion. No, you can't use USB for the initial setup if there's a label covering the port.

You have to set it up wirelessly first using the HP Smart app and an internet connection. After it's fully configured and on your Wi-Fi network, you can then print using a USB cable if you want. But even for USB printing later, the printer itself must stay connected to the internet.

If you're stuck: If HP Smart can't find the printer during wireless setup, the most likely culprit is the printer's setup mode timing out. Swipe down on the touchscreen, go to Network Setup > Restore Network Settings, confirm, wait a minute, and try the app again.
